Output 31ba7ee01af77d86db2114ae3412aa2bfa5fc54976b922f081a719cbe787058a:0

value
16823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1c8f05d1677537a42004e2f9628c64e3502466e OP_EQUAL
address
3KMf43jeKXi7yB4XMaGn9pyt1KwWHwgrfp
transaction
31ba7ee01af77d86db2114ae3412aa2bfa5fc54976b922f081a719cbe787058a
spent
true